Misty Double Glazing Repair

Misty double glazing occurs when the airtight seal that holds the two panes of glass in a double-glazed window fails. This allows moisture to flow through and reduces the insulating properties of the window.

It can be cheaper to repair your windows professionally rather than replacing the entire window. This will ensure that you don't suffer further damage or condensation problems.

Seals

The window seal (also known as a upvc repairs near me seal) is vital to keep your double glazing in top condition. If your window seals are damaged or worn, they'll no longer provide airtight seal and could result in drafts, energy loss, and even misty glass between the panes of your double-glazed.

A damaged window seal could also affect the thermal efficiency of your home, and can increase the cost of energy. The failure of window seals could cause up to 20% of the heat to escape through your doors and windows. It is essential to repair a window seal when you notice it to minimize the impact.

The main reason that windows with double glazing become foggy is because the seal breaks down or fails which allows air to pass between the two panes of glass and creating fogging and condensation. This could be due to a number of reasons, including age (seals aren't guaranteed to last for long), weather conditions and the way your windows were installed in the first in the first.

There are several methods to fix a misty double glazed window, including drilling a small hole and blowing warm air into it or filling the gap with a clear cement. However, these options are only temporary and won't fix the cause of the issue which is a damaged window seal. If you want to avoid expensive repair costs, it's best to consult a professional glazier who can replace the window seals and return your double glazing to its optimal condition.

A professional glazier will apply premium silicone sealant for the repair to ensure that it's airtight and durable enough. They'll employ a gasket roller to push the new seal into the desired location, making sure that it's properly and evenly applied. They'll also look over the gap for any signs of a blow-off seal and replace or repair them as needed. When you seal your double glazing, you'll enjoy improved energy savings and comfort at home.

Sealant

If the seal has been damaged it is possible for moisture to enter and cause mist. This is usually caused by wear and tear or just ageing. As temperatures fluctuate, the gasses in the double-glazed unit expand and contract which creates pressure on the seal, this causes it to weaken over time. This could be caused by inadequate installation or damage that occurs during construction.

This is why it's so important to get your windows installed properly. DG Servicing has years of experience in installing and repairing window seals. The right seal will prevent drafts and loss of energy, and keep your windows looking brand new.

A crack or break in a black sealant that keeps the glass panes and the silver spacer bars is the primary reason for a double-glazed failure. The sealant is referred to as hot melt and is a pretty tough material so if it gets damaged, it can cause air to enter the double glazed unit, causing condensation and misty windows.

To fix a glass that has been misted, you must first take off any old sealant. It is possible to use a knife however, it is better to use a sealant remover. This will make the job easier and speedier. When using a knife on any kind or pane of glass be sure not to use too much pressure.

Once the sealant has been removed, double glazing repair take the glass's top layer and place it on a flat surface safe where it won't be damaged. Once the pane is out, it is a good idea to mark the glass's face on the glass using a non-permanent marker to help you put it back in the proper position.

You will need a high-quality sealant to replace double-glazed windows. It must be water resistant, weather and thermal. It should also be able to join the two panes together, as well as the frame. The glass will break down faster and be less durable if you choose an inferior sealant that is cheap and low-quality.

Glass

Windows are a key feature of any home, offering airflow, light and connection to the outside. However, they can also be major sources of energy loss. The gas contained in double-glazed windows can deplete over time, resulting in misted glass and reduced insulation. Regular maintenance and a quality installation can stop this.

Most people think that a misty double-glazing window indicates that the frame has failed, however this isn't the scenario. It's usually the seal that has failed, allowing the insulating gas between the panes to escape. This can be fixed by replacing the seal, not the entire window. This is a cheaper alternative and will save money in the long run. It is also a great chance to upgrade to energy efficient glass A-rated, which will also increase your savings.

Double-glazed units that fail are also known as windows that are steamed up. This occurs when the hot melt sealant that creates a seal between two panes of glass fails. This causes moisture to accumulate inside the window over time. This moisture will then cool and condense into liquid. It can be seen as steam-like streaks on the interior of the double-glazed window, and it will appear worse on warmer days.

At first, the issue may appear to be solved through inserting warm air into the window. This is a temporary solution, but it can be helpful. It is also important to avoid extreme temperature fluctuations, as this can cause condensation and the build-up of moisture up. Make sure that the temperature remains as stable as is possible.
